pantomimic
/ˌpæntəˈmɪmɪk/Definitions
1. adjective
imitating or resembling pantomime; having the power or faculty of imitating actions or movements without words
“The pantomimic performance on stage was mesmerizing.”
2. adverb
in a manner that imitates pantomime; without words
“She pantomimically pointed to the map to ask for directions.”
